    Actually late Spring 1990 – as a graduation present to myself from grad school, I went to Berlin to visit friends. It was after the wall was breached but before it was down or before East Germany had reunified. Friends and I walked all over “no man’s land”, went into the hated guard towers, and then took our sledge hammers and smashed away on the Berlin Wall till we had knocked some of it off. That was very hard – but it felt so good!
